Angry How to remove baked on mud?

I have a 07 Street Bob with a black engine. I had to ride a few miles in road construction behind a water truck. Got baked on mud all over engine, cases, exaust, you name it. Got home and washed and scrubbed with soap but can still see where the mud was, especially on the engine fins. Does anybody know how to get this stuff off?

S100 Engine Brite. I'll use WD-40 on the engine and exhaust parts before I wash it and it'll usually help take off any unwanted residue. Might be other things but these work for me.

S100 works great, but ya gotta use it on a cold engine, & hose it off immediately! I've also found that black shoe polish works well on black engine parts. Use sparingly.
